In the planning phase of your social media strategy you must first collect the current number of followers, fans, likes, and subscribers your organisation has. This will give you an idea of the current reach your organisation holds. In addition, your organisation should create a goal of how many new users you plan to reach. For example, if you have 1000 follower, how many more do you want to reach by the end of your campaign?
First step is to ensure social goals solve challenges. Meaning to say goal setting is the pin of all marketing and business strategies. With a variety of social capabilities, it can be complicated to establish exactly what the objectives should be. A company should find out the challenges that a company will be facing and should have a solution for it. Second step is to extend efforts throughout the organization. Creating a fully integrated social media marketing campaign, a company needs to be engross and combine multiple departments, especially if the goals have a direct impact on them. Third step is to focus on networks that add value. Every network has its own advantages and disadvantages. A company should carefully pick and choose which networks they want to take advantage of. An example of this social media sites are Facebook, Twitter, Google+, etc. Fourth step is to create engaging content. Which means to say that the company’s content should get the consumers interest that lets them engage in your company’s brand. Fifth step is to identify business opportunities through social.
